Ordinals
beta
Sat 1500928003272036
decimal
390371.503272036
degree
0°180371′1283″503272036‴
percentile
71.47276213919321%
name
dfhsjwmypmb
cycle
0
epoch
1
period
193
block
390371
offset
503272036
timestamp
2015-12-27 01:05:39 UTC
rarity
common
prev
next